 To CCF! This coin has been cut by force. Just PMD. Not an error. Also a Vise Job, on the reverse. The backwards impressions give it away. If it was actually Double Struck, the letters wouldn't be backwards. Just a badly damaged cent. Also, you posted in the wrong forum.
